Oman - Re-Export of Footwear Incorporating a Protective Metal Toe-Cap with Uppers of Leather
In 2019, the country was ranked number 6 among other countries in Re-Export of Footwear Incorporating a Protective Metal Toe-Cap with Uppers of Leather with $224,344.18. Oman is overtaken by New Zealand, which was ranked number 5 with $881,183.33 and is followed by Saudi Arabia at $222,248.28. United Arab Emirates lead the ranking with $21,435,952.17 in 2019, a decrease of 2.2% compared to 2018. United States, Bahrain and Canada resp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Guyana recorded the best 5 years average growth at +129.7% per year, while Uganda witnessed the worst performance at -60.4% per year.
